Fault determining apparatus, fault determining method and engine control unit for variable valve timing mechanism

   
   

A fault determining apparatus for a variable valve timing mechanism is provided for shortly and accurately determining a fault even at low oil temperatures. The mechanism is driven by an oil pressure to change a cam phase of an intake cam and/or an exhaust cam with respect to a crank shaft of an internal combustion engine, thereby controlling the actual cam phase to reach a target cam phase. The apparatus has a fault determining routine executed by an ECU (electric control unit) for determining that the mechanism is faulty when a cam phase difference between the target cam phase and the actual cam phase is not within a predetermined range, an oil temperature sensor for detecting the temperature of the working oil, and a correcting routine executed by the ECU for correcting the predetermined range in an increasing direction when the detected oil temperature is low.
